Микроконтроллеры, АЦП, память и т.д Темы касающиеся микроконтроллеров разных производителей, памяти, АЦП/ЦАП, периферийных модулей... |
31.01.2011, 19:56
|
|
Вид на жительство
Регистрация: 29.01.2010
Адрес: Десногорск Смол.обл.
Сообщений: 333
Сказал спасибо: 17
Сказали Спасибо 256 раз(а) в 103 сообщении(ях)
|
Re: АЦП USB
Сообщение от Ivanbiv
|
Я так понял PIC18F14K50 имеет 9 каналов АЦП как же они работают?
Допустим я подключу ко всем к ним сигнал, как я могу с ними работать через USB?
|
ПИК имеет 9 аналоговых входов, подав на которые измеряемый сигнал можно программно подключать каждый из них к модулю АЦП, который в свою очередь оцифровывает аналоговый сигнал (напряжение) на этих входах преобразуя его в цифровое 10-ти битное значение. Далее получив цифровой код в виде двухбайтной переменной типа WORD можно используя аппаратный модуль УСБ, сконфигурированный как виртуальный ком-порт передать данные в терминал ПК. Можно сконфигурировать УСБ контроллера как HID устройство, и так же передавать данные программе в ПК, которая будет собирать эти значения и т.д.
а вообще думаю рановато начинать с АЦП и УСБ.. я бы сперва светодиодами помограл для получения представления о том как работает микроконтроллер. и для этого совершенно не нужно иметь программатор и микроконтроллер. тут хорошо поможет протеус (proteus 7.7). на этом сайте его можно взять и тут же подробно расписано как с ним работать.
п.с. ранее выкладывал ссылку на производителя. там даташит на МК где каждый модуль расписан подробно производителем, как конфигурировать конкретно каждый модуль МК, какой бит за что отвечает и т.д.
|
|
|
|
31.01.2011, 20:03
|
|
Почётный гражданин KAZUS.RU
Регистрация: 07.03.2005
Сообщений: 1,056
Сказал спасибо: 1
Сказали Спасибо 250 раз(а) в 174 сообщении(ях)
|
Re: АЦП USB
Сообщение от Ivanbiv
|
Может быть есть готовый вариант
|
http://www.chipdip.ru/product/pcs10.aspx
Цитата:
|
DLL included for your own developments
|
|
|
|
|
31.01.2011, 20:22
|
|
Частый гость
Регистрация: 31.01.2011
Сообщений: 27
Сказал спасибо: 1
Сказали Спасибо 11 раз(а) в 11 сообщении(ях)
|
Re: АЦП USB
Vadim_sh, спасибо Вам. Я почти убежден использовать PIC18F14K50, или аналог.
В чем недостаток jdm программатора использования для PIC18F14K50?
Я несколько конкретизировал требования для устройства:
1) многоканальность. Как я представляю, есть каналы входа в АЦП, через USB с ПК я указываю, с какого канала хочу получить значение, далее запрашиваю значение с АЦП и в ответ получаю его.
2) 10 разряюов вполне достаточно.
3) возможность тем или иным способом менять границы анализируемого диапазона напряжений.
Мне интересно, сколько это будет стоить если заказать такое устройство, может быть мне проще заказать его. Пишите либо сюда, либо в личку.
|
|
|
|
31.01.2011, 20:56
|
|
Вид на жительство
Регистрация: 29.01.2010
Адрес: Десногорск Смол.обл.
Сообщений: 333
Сказал спасибо: 17
Сказали Спасибо 256 раз(а) в 103 сообщении(ях)
|
Re: АЦП USB
Ivanbiv, рекомендую почитать ЭТО
думаю множество вопросов отпадет
|
|
|
|
31.01.2011, 21:10
|
|
Прописка
Регистрация: 23.01.2008
Сообщений: 102
Сказал спасибо: 0
Сказали Спасибо 21 раз(а) в 19 сообщении(ях)
|
Re: АЦП USB
Ну раз пошла тема освоения USB, то можно глянуть и эту статейку.
|
|
|
|
31.01.2011, 22:45
|
|
Временная регистрация
Регистрация: 24.09.2010
Сообщений: 60
Сказал спасибо: 1
Сказали Спасибо 23 раз(а) в 19 сообщении(ях)
|
Re: АЦП USB
Скорострельность Вам большая не нужна. Вот если бы по сом-порту связь соорудить, все обошлось бы намного дешевле и проще.
Более чем уверен, что у умеющего програмить уже есть опыт работы с последовательным портом. А здесь и контроллер нужен попроще, подешевле. И софт в контроллер будет более понятен и потому проще.
И уж если использовать USB-кабель от мобилок, в которых уже встроен преобразователь USB-UART, то простота реализации налицо. Да и скорострельность будет повыше, чем у простого сом-порта.
Где-то у меня даже какой-то проектик на АВР_ке валялся...
Тут уж проще наверное способа и не придумаешь.
Но это так, в копилку возможных вариантов.
|
|
|
|
31.01.2011, 22:59
|
|
Частый гость
Регистрация: 31.01.2011
Сообщений: 27
Сказал спасибо: 1
Сказали Спасибо 11 раз(а) в 11 сообщении(ях)
|
Re: АЦП USB
aleksey_gregul, благодарю. Я любой вариант рассмотрю, чтоб найти то, что надо.
|
|
|
|
31.01.2011, 23:02
|
|
Гражданин KAZUS.RU
Регистрация: 14.11.2008
Сообщений: 701
Сказал спасибо: 298
Сказали Спасибо 283 раз(а) в 193 сообщении(ях)
|
Re: АЦП USB
Позвольте и мне добавить, может пригодится.
http://www.usbdev.org.ru/?p=usbadc
|
|
|
|
31.01.2011, 23:03
|
|
Частый гость
Регистрация: 31.01.2011
Сообщений: 27
Сказал спасибо: 1
Сказали Спасибо 11 раз(а) в 11 сообщении(ях)
|
Re: АЦП USB
Сообщение от Vadim_sh
|
Ivanbiv, рекомендую почитать ЭТО
думаю множество вопросов отпадет
|
Спасибо, надеюсь поможет.
Pit_PB, спасибо Вам.
Спасибо всем, кто помогает найти оптимальное решение, дешевого и легкого в исполнений устройства АЦП USB.
Последний раз редактировалось Ivanbiv; 31.01.2011 в 23:06.
|
|
|
|
01.02.2011, 00:02
|
|
Частый гость
Регистрация: 31.01.2011
Сообщений: 27
Сказал спасибо: 1
Сказали Спасибо 11 раз(а) в 11 сообщении(ях)
|
Re: АЦП USB
Такой вопрос, возможно в скором времени пригодится:
МК можно ли повторно прошивать, если да, то сколько примерно раз он терпит перепрошивку?
|
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Часовой пояс GMT +4, время: 00:54.
|
|